R Spatial Notebooks

A Guide to Reproducible Spatial Workflows for Social Science Research

The R Spatial Notebook Series is a collection of interactive code notebooks designed to help researchers, analysts, and data practitioners build reproducible spatial workflows in R. These notebooks cover automated data extraction from key social and environmental data sources (IPUMS, Natural Earth, OpenStreetMap, and more), spatial data cleaning and integration, foundational and advanced spatial analysis techniques, and mapping methods.

The series is structured like a book—earlier chapters provide foundational concepts necessary for later work. Each notebook is also a standalone resource that can be downloaded and adapted for your specific research and educational needs.

Whether you're new to spatial data science or an experienced R programmer expanding your workflows, these notebooks support your journey in spatial analysis with R.

Project FAQ

Why Jupyter Notebooks instead of R Markdown?

This project was developed during my postdoctoral work with the University of Minnesota and the NSF I-GUIDE project. The notebooks were designed specifically for the I-GUIDE platform, which supports Jupyter Notebooks. R Markdown versions may be made available in the future based on community interest.
